Kigali City Schools Inspections Continue

Kigali City authorities have started inspecting schools aimed at assessing the quality of education in Kigali based schools and identifying how schools are using Education Values to promote and develop Rwanda’s Education Sector.

Two firsts Schools that will rank in best performers will receive an Extra Prize.

The city council Department in charge of conducting the inspection activities launched its visits on January 22, to various schools located in Kimihurura and Kacyiru Sectors.

The inspections in these sectors were focused on infrastructure development, administration, School materials and many others.

However, some schools including; G S Kacyiru II, ES Kacyiru and GS Rugando, still lack quality Education, low Hygiene, lack of planning of lessons and many other problems.

La Colombière, was commended for its higher performance in safety and quality education.

The School also performed well in National Examinations.

The inspections have found that schools have improved, however the city inspector of schools, Marthe Yankurije, has uged schools that are lacking to report their problems to the Ministry of Education so that they can have necessary Education materials.
